Other Crafts

Leis
supplies:plastic lacing, colored straws cut up in 1” sections or pony beads.
artificial flowers - Hydrangeas are perfect since the hole is already there.
-Disassemble flowers. Only keep petals. Punch or poke holes in the center of all flower petals. Alternate threading flower petals with straw sections (or 2-3 pony beads.)Tie when finished.
Garbage bag Hula Skirt
supplies: plastic garbage bags with cinch handle (2 per child) no gathers at bottom, needs to lay flat. Kirkland bags from Costco work great, permanent markers to decorate.
-Color tropical designs, verses, themes, truths, etc… on bags.
Cut bottom off both bags. Cut 1”-2” strips up to cinch tie with out cutting it.
Wear both bags at the same time. The static cling can get pretty out-of-control. I haven’t tried it yet, but was thinking that some spray starch or static spray would probably help.
Sand art paper
supplies: Colored sand (make by shaking light colored craft sand with few drops of food coloring,)Preprinted coloring pages on cardstock (use clipart from Lifeway website,)Paint-able glue (make by watering down Elmer’s or Tacky glue,)Old paint brushes, Markers
-Children color the picture first. Paint small amounts of glue and apply desired sand color. Shake and repeat for each new color.
Lacing canvas
supplies: plastic canvas any size, mine is about 5x6, plastic lacing various colors
Cut off 12-18” sections of lacing and thread through canvas to create desired designs.
Class Photo Frame – Best for last day, to have time to print photos
supplies: cardboard frames (this craft was inspired by the 60 leftover frames from several years ago,)Enough class photos for each child take at the beginning of the week, markers, tropical stickers
-Have children decorate frame, Attach photo
